What OUTFRONT Media is, in dealership terms

OUTFRONT Media is one of the largest outdoor companies, with billboards, transit advertising on buses, rail and stations, and large digital screens concentrated in the biggest American metros, where its inventory covers the highways, the downtowns and the transit systems that millions of commuters use daily. Digital faces are sold directly and through the programmatic outdoor platforms; printed and transit placements are sold through local offices.

For a dealership in a major metro, OUTFRONT is where the highway faces and the transit inventory are. A digital billboard on the freeway that passes the auto row, a station domination near a downtown showroom, a bus wrap on the routes through the store's zone: those are its formats. Its footprint is thin in small markets, where Lamar and the regional companies hold the faces.

Why a dealership would spend money on OUTFRONT Media

A store spends with OUTFRONT for highway and transit reach in a major metro, at scale, with digital faces that can be bought by daypart and programmatically. For a group with several rooftops along one freeway, a sequence of faces on that freeway is a classic and effective buy.

The honest objection is the outdoor objection, no direct response and a slow read through branded search and traffic, plus rates in the largest metros that reflect the audience size. Transit placements commit for weeks, and the footprint is metro only. It is a brand and location channel for big city stores.

Who OUTFRONT Media fits, and who it does not

OUTFRONT fits dealerships and groups in the largest metros with highway and transit inventory to buy, franchise stores with a location message, and luxury stores near downtown showrooms. It fits less well outside the big metros and for stores that need direct response.

What a OUTFRONT Media lead looks like when it reaches the CRM

An OUTFRONT sourced lead reaches the CRM as a branded search, a call to the number on the face, or a walk in with the source recorded, attributed over weeks. The CRM's reporting shows branded search lift in the zone during the flight, and a short URL or texting keyword on a digital face adds a little direct response.

Targeting the market you actually sell in

A dealership is a local business, so every channel LeadLocate runs is planned around a zone: a radius around the store, a set of counties, or a whole state for a group. The zone editor in Leads Manager is where that is drawn, and it applies to OUTFRONT Media the same way it applies to search or social. Auto brokers and stores that ship nationally can widen the zone to the country; a Toyota store in one city has no reason to pay for shoppers in another, and does not. Groups give each rooftop its own zone so two stores in the same group never bid against each other for the same household. One rule worth knowing before you plan a financing campaign: campaigns that mention financing run under fair lending rules, which do not allow narrowing an audience by age, gender, income, marital status, household size, education, language or ZIP, and Leads Manager locks those controls. Vehicle and geography targeting is unaffected.

Frequently Asked Questions

Does OUTFRONT cover small markets?

Its inventory is concentrated in the largest metros. In small and mid sized markets, Lamar and regional companies hold most of the faces, and the programmatic outdoor platforms reach across all of them.

What transit formats work for a dealership?

Bus wraps and interior cards on routes through the store's zone, and station placements near a downtown showroom. They commit for weeks and reach commuters daily.

How is an outdoor flight measured?

By branded search lift in the zone during the flight, calls to the number on the face, and walk ins logged with the source in the CRM, read over weeks.
